Your Role:


  • Support civil engineering design for renewable energy, storage, utility transmission, and related projects.
  • Conduct construction monitoring and provide field support.
  • Perform stormwater compliance inspections for ongoing projects.
  • Prepare stormwater management plans and hydrologic modeling.
  • Support nationwide engineering and design initiatives across the company network.
  • Assist with construction administration tasks, including submittal review, RFIs, and site visits.

Qualifications:


  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il or Environmental Engineering.
  • 0–3 years of professional engineering experience.
  • Engineering in Training (EIT) certification.
  • Proficiency in AutoCAD Civil 3D and HydroCAD.
  • Strong skills in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int).
  • Must possess a valid driver’s license with a clean driving record without restrictions.


Preferred Skills & Experience:


  • Experience with site development projects in renewable energy, battery storage, and/or utility transmission.
  • Preparation of Stormwater Pollution Prevention Plans (SWPPPs) and/or stormwater compliance inspections.
  • New York State Stormwater Management Inspector Certification.
  • Construction oversight and permitting experience in New York State.
  • Experience with electrical infrastructure, environmental investigation/remediation, or environmental due diligence.
  • HAZWOPER certification.
